Output c56bc43505b609616f2235471abf402861e16680fb55e3b26f5241c8d87b5cdb:3

value
270261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b19a66ddb41ff0f4254381123d2191f31ee8b6bc OP_EQUAL
address
3Ht6VXMzBHhgx2DATPURJEwppZQcbbSFDQ
transaction
c56bc43505b609616f2235471abf402861e16680fb55e3b26f5241c8d87b5cdb
confirmations
332135
spent
true